1 mg Progynova (Estradiol) Tablets are a form of estrogen hormone replacement therapy (HRT) commonly used for the treatment of conditions related to low estrogen levels. Here are the main uses of Progynova:
Menopausal Symptoms: Progynova is primarily used to treat symptoms of menopause such as hot flashes, night sweats, vaginal dryness, and mood swings. As women approach menopause, their estrogen levels naturally decline, which can cause these symptoms. Progynova helps to restore estrogen levels, alleviating these symptoms.
Hormone Replacement Therapy (HRT): Progynova is used as part of HRT to manage estrogen deficiency in women who have gone through menopause. It is often prescribed to prevent osteoporosis (bone loss) that can occur due to decreased estrogen levels, as well as to support overall hormone balance.
Premature Menopause: For women who experience premature menopause (before the age of 40), Progynova may be prescribed to replace the estrogen that their body is no longer producing, helping to manage symptoms and protect against long-term health issues, such as osteoporosis and heart disease.
Hormonal Imbalances: Progynova may be used to address certain hormonal imbalances, including cases of hypoestrogenism (low estrogen levels), which can be caused by various medical conditions or treatments (such as surgery or radiation therapy).
Post-Surgical Treatment: It may be used after surgeries like hysterectomy (removal of the uterus) to replace estrogen and maintain hormonal balance, particularly when the ovaries are also removed.
Vaginal Atrophy: Progynova can also help treat vaginal atrophy, a condition where the vaginal tissues become thinner and less elastic due to a lack of estrogen, leading to symptoms like vaginal dryness and discomfort during intercourse.
Progynova is typically used as a part of a broader treatment plan, often in combination with progestogens (like progesterone), especially for women who have not had a hysterectomy. It's essential to use this medication under a doctor's guidance, as estrogen therapy carries certain risks, such as an increased risk of blood clots, stroke, and certain cancers, depending on individual health factors.

200 mg Endogest (Progesterone) Capsules are used for various gynecological and reproductive health conditions. Endogest contains progesterone, a natural hormone that plays a key role in regulating the menstrual cycle, maintaining pregnancy, and supporting hormonal balance. Here are the primary uses of Endogest (Progesterone 200 mg):
Support for Early Pregnancy: Endogest is commonly used to support early pregnancy, particularly in women who have difficulty maintaining a pregnancy or have a history of recurrent miscarriages. It is often prescribed when there is a progesterone deficiency, which can impair the implantation of the fertilized egg and the maintenance of the pregnancy. Progesterone helps stabilize the uterine lining, which is crucial for a successful pregnancy.
Luteal Phase Support in IVF: Endogest is frequently used during in vitro fertilization (IVF) procedures to provide luteal phase support. After egg retrieval and embryo transfer, progesterone is necessary to maintain the uterine lining and support implantation. Endogest is given to improve the chances of a successful pregnancy after IVF.
Hormonal Imbalance: Endogest can be prescribed to regulate hormonal imbalances that cause irregular menstrual cycles. It is particularly useful in cases of luteal phase defect, where progesterone levels are insufficient in the second half of the menstrual cycle, leading to problems like anovulation, irregular periods, or difficulty conceiving.
Treatment of Endometriosis: Endogest is sometimes used to treat endometriosis, a condition where tissue similar to the uterine lining grows outside the uterus. Progesterone helps reduce the growth of endometrial tissue and can help alleviate symptoms such as pain and irregular bleeding.
Hormonal Replacement Therapy (HRT): In some cases, Endogest is used as part of HRT in postmenopausal women, especially when estrogen therapy is prescribed. Progesterone is added to protect the uterus from the effects of estrogen, such as the risk of endometrial hyperplasia or uterine cancer, in women who have not had a hysterectomy.
Abnormal Uterine Bleeding: Endogest can be used to treat abnormal uterine bleeding, especially when the bleeding is due to hormonal imbalances, like in cases of perimenopause or irregular menstrual cycles.
Prevention of Preterm Birth: In some cases, Endogest may be used to help prevent preterm birth in women at high risk. It supports the pregnancy by reducing the chances of early labor.

10 mg Dydroboon (Dydrogesterone) Tablets are used for various gynecological and hormonal conditions. Dydrogesterone is a synthetic progestogen, similar to the naturally occurring hormone progesterone. Here are the main uses of Dydroboon (Dydrogesterone):
Irregular Menstrual Cycles: Dydroboon is commonly used to treat irregular menstrual cycles caused by hormonal imbalances. It helps regulate the menstrual cycle by supporting the second half of the cycle (luteal phase), which may be insufficient in some women.
Secondary Amenorrhea: Dydroboon is used to treat secondary amenorrhea, a condition where menstruation stops for several months in women who previously had normal menstrual cycles. It can help restart menstruation by regulating hormonal levels.
Endometriosis: Dydroboon may be prescribed as part of the treatment for endometriosis, a condition where tissue similar to the uterine lining grows outside the uterus, leading to pain, irregular bleeding, and infertility. Dydrogesterone helps to reduce the overgrowth of endometrial tissue and alleviate symptoms.
Hormonal Replacement Therapy (HRT): In women undergoing HRT (often alongside estrogen therapy), Dydroboon is used to balance estrogen's effects on the uterus, preventing the thickening of the endometrial lining and reducing the risk of endometrial cancer. It is often used in women with a uterus who are receiving estrogen therapy for menopausal symptoms.
Prevention of Miscarriage: Dydroboon is sometimes used to help prevent miscarriage in women with a history of recurrent pregnancy loss, particularly when a progesterone deficiency is suspected as the cause. It helps to support the uterine lining during early pregnancy.
Progestogen Therapy for Infertility: Dydroboon may be used in cases of infertility related to hormonal imbalances, such as insufficient progesterone production. By normalizing the progesterone levels, it supports implantation and early pregnancy maintenance.
Abnormal Uterine Bleeding: Dydroboon can be prescribed to treat abnormal uterine bleeding, which may occur due to hormonal imbalances or other gynecological issues. It helps restore the balance of hormones and control bleeding.
Dydroboon works by mimicking the action of natural progesterone, regulating the menstrual cycle, stabilizing the endometrial lining, and supporting pregnancy. The 10 mg dose is commonly used for these conditions, but the specific dosage and duration of treatment will vary depending on the individual’s condition and response to therapy.

200 mg Susten (Progesterone) Capsules are commonly used for various medical purposes related to hormone therapy. Susten contains progesterone, a natural hormone that plays a key role in regulating the menstrual cycle and maintaining pregnancy. Below are the main uses of Susten 200 mg Capsules:
Hormone Replacement Therapy (HRT): Susten is often used in combination with estrogen as part of HRT in postmenopausal women. This therapy helps to alleviate symptoms of menopause, such as hot flashes, vaginal dryness, and mood changes. Progesterone is added to reduce the risk of endometrial (uterine) cancer, which can occur when estrogen is used alone.
Support for Early Pregnancy: Susten is commonly used in early pregnancy, especially for women who have difficulty maintaining a pregnancy. It is often prescribed in cases of luteal phase defects (when the body does not produce enough progesterone during the second half of the menstrual cycle), or for women undergoing in vitro fertilization (IVF). The hormone helps support the early stages of pregnancy by promoting the implantation of the fertilized egg and maintaining the uterine lining.
Irregular Menstrual Cycles: Progesterone, as in Susten, can be prescribed to treat irregular menstrual cycles caused by hormonal imbalances, such as those seen in conditions like pol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). It helps regulate the menstrual cycle and can assist in restoring normal periods.
Threatened Miscarriage: In some cases, Susten is used to treat threatened miscarriage or to support women who have had a history of recurrent pregnancy loss, especially when low progesterone levels are suspected to be a factor in miscarriage.
Endometrial Protection During Estrogen Therapy: For women taking estrogen therapy, Susten is often used to prevent the overgrowth of the uterine lining (endometrium), which can occur with estrogen use. This is especially important for women who have an intact uterus.
Prevention of Preterm Birth: In certain cases, Susten can be prescribed to women at risk of preterm birth to help maintain pregnancy and prevent early labor.
Susten works by increasing progesterone levels in the body, which helps regulate various aspects of the reproductive system, including preparing the uterus for pregnancy and supporting early pregnancy. The 200 mg dose is often used for specific conditions, and the treatment is typically personalized based on individual needs and response. Regular monitoring is important, especially when using Susten to support pregnancy or in combination with other hormone therapies.
